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/owncloud/client.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orOlivier Goffart <ogoffart@woboq.com>2015-04-17 18:56:17 +0300
committerOlivier Goffart <ogoffart@woboq.com>2015-04-17 18:56:17 +0300
commita932eac832b442cca763197240f036905dd284da (patch)
treee051a71ad8e0605deb5ab12f1138ad562c73019f /src/gui/settingsdialog.h
parent2da3bfb96f2e1ac0860e28903c1956065627f5d2 (diff)
Multi-account WIP
Diffstat (limited to 'src/gui/settingsdialog.h')
-rw-r--r--src/gui/settingsdialog.h7
1 files changed, 5 insertions, 2 deletions
diff --git a/src/gui/settingsdialog.h b/src/gui/settingsdialog.h
index 002e4a204..f8e311a0a 100644
--- a/src/gui/settingsdialog.h
+++ b/src/gui/settingsdialog.h
@@ -24,6 +24,8 @@ class QStandardItemModel;
namespace OCC {
+class AccountState;
+
namespace Ui {
class SettingsDialog;
}
@@ -41,7 +43,6 @@ public:
~SettingsDialog();
void addAccount(const QString &title, QWidget *widget);
- void setGeneralErrors( const QStringList& errors );
public slots:
void showActivityPage();
@@ -52,12 +53,14 @@ protected:
void accept() Q_DECL_OVERRIDE;
private slots:
+ void accountAdded(AccountState *);
+ void accountRemoved(AccountState *);
private:
Ui::SettingsDialog * const _ui;
QHash<QAction*, QWidget*> _actions;
- AccountSettings * const _accountSettings;
QAction * _protocolAction;
+ ownCloudGui *_gui;
};
}